Ruler in un palais (3 letter answer)

The Answer




The answer ROI is seen frequently, appearing about once every 80 puzzles.

Related Clues

ROI as a noun:

1. (return on invested capital, return on investment, ROI) = (corporate finance) the amount, expressed as a percentage, that is earned on a company's total capital calculated by dividing the total capital into earnings before interest, taxes, or dividends are paid